Cyclingflash
Info
Last nameCrawforth
First nameBen
Nationality
GB flagUnited Kingdom
About Ben Crawforth

Ben Crawforth is a British cycling professional, 0 years old.

Results
DateRankRace
31-01DNFFR flagUCI Cyclo-cross World Championships U19 (CM)